These are the events structsd writes onto the Tendermint ABCI log. They are not GRASS NATS messages and they are not Guild API planet-activity rows. Sync-state reads this log and then writes PostgreSQL; GRASS and the REST activity feed are that projection, not the original events.

Tendermint WebSocket: wss://public.testnet.structs.network:26657/websocket
Typed gameplay events from message handlers land on tm.event='Tx'. EventTime is emitted from begin-blocker (EmitEventTime) and lands on block events (tm.event='NewBlock'), not on a tx.
After the fact, the same array is on GET https://public.testnet.structs.network/cosmos/tx/v1beta1/txs/{hash}.
Typed-event type is the proto message name. Verified in keeper tests: structs.structs.EventAttack. Subscribe to all txs and filter that type, or query the container attribute:
{
"jsonrpc": "2.0",
"method": "subscribe",
"id": 1,
"params": {
"query": "tm.event='Tx' AND structs.structs.EventAttack.eventAttackDetail EXISTS"
}
}
EventTime uses tm.event='NewBlock' and structs.structs.EventTime.eventTimeDetail EXISTS. Parse with Cosmos ParseTypedEvent (or equivalent). Do not treat these as GRASS category strings.
Guild Stack sync_state.raw_events / raw_attributes only fill when SYNC_STATE_MIRROR_RAW=true (Compose default is false).
EmitTypedEvent)Almost every Structs gameplay event is a protobuf message. The proto wraps the payload in a container so the indexer stores one JSON blob rather than one ABCI attribute per field:
EventAttack { eventAttackDetail: { ... } }
EventDelete { objectId: "6-1" } // single-field messages skip the wrapper
ABCI attributes are proto JSON: camelCase keys, uint64 as strings. Nested objects (the attack shot array, a full Player record) sit under the container field name.
sdk.NewEvent)ugc_moderated is an untyped Cosmos event (x/structs/types/events_ugc.go). Type string is exactly ugc_moderated. Attributes are snake_case strings.
Reactor infusion / defusion / migration / cancel-defusion also emit Cosmos staking events (delegate, unbond, redelegate, cancel_unbonding_delegation) on the same tx. IBC packet code emits timeout. Those are not Structs gameplay types; they ride along when those messages run.
type below is the Tendermint event.Type string (structs.structs. + message name), except ugc_moderated.

On block height 1 the keeper also replays genesis (EventAllGenesis) as the same typed events so an indexer can bootstrap without scanning history.

GRASS struct_attack can be a stub (~8 KB NATS cap). The chain EventAttack is the full proto.

Self-service UGC updates are silent. pfpClientRenderAttributes is owner-only and does not take this path. Full rules: ugc-moderation.md.

Do not subscribe to these as a live signal.
structs-sync-state consumes this log and writes tables. Some planet_activity categories (shield_change, block_raid_start) are derived from attribute writes and have no chain event of their own. A GRASS struct_attack stub has no shot detail; structs.structs.EventAttack on the tx does.
